Lithuania - Root Crops Area

Since 2014, Lithuania Root Crops Area was down by 5.6% year on year. At 34.13 Thousand Hectares in 2019, the country was number 17 among other countries in Root Crops Area. Lithuania is overtaken by Bosnia and Herzegovina, which was number 16 with 35.05 Thousand Hectares and is followed by Finland at 32.3 Thousand Hectares. Germany ranked the highest with 684.1 Thousand Hectares in 2019, that is an increase of 2% versus 2018. France, Poland and Turkey resp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Poland recorded the best 5 years average growth at +2.8% per year, while Greece was the worst growing country at -11.4% per year.
